调用notifyDataSetChanged()使getView()多次执行

时间:2017-09-23 14:51:25

标签: android listview baseadapter notifydatasetchanged

我正在使用自定义BaseAdapter来显示listdata,每当listitem发生更改时,我正在调用notifyDataSetChanged(),但它会多次调用getView()方法,我已经{{1}到android:layout_height="fill_parent"。如果每次调用ListView只调用一次,它将解决我的问题。

1 个答案:

答案 0 :(得分:0)

这是我的错。我没有在ListView等不同的布局文件中将android:layout_height="fill_parent"更新为layout-hdpi